The most common and recent 7-letter answer for "Consumes without enthusiasm" is PECKSAT.
The phrase 'pecks at' describes eating in a tentative or unenthusiastic way, similar to how a bird might peck at food without fully committing to eating it. The clue suggests a lack of enthusiasm in consumption, which aligns with this imagery.
